It appears that Jordan Brand will really be forcing us to make some tough decisions in 2010 thanks to all the tempting releases in store. With numerous Retro models making their way back in a bunch of colorways, we all have plenty of good reason to stash some money aside or get a second job. Above are two more additions to the 2010 Air Jordan line-up that are going to be pretty hard to pass up for most Air Jordan collectors. The Infrared Air Jordan VI is pretty much a no-brainer, especially because, unlike the Black version which made the switch to suede, this pair sticks with the original White leather. Joining the Infrared VI’s will be another new Spiz’ike this time decked out in a “Grape” color scheme, which needless to say is always a fan favorite with most sneakerheads. No word yet on specific release info, but stay tuned for further details. Via Opium.
